Mission

Net-Centric Operations Division (NCOD) leads the Joint Planning and

Development Office (JPDO), agency partners, and industry to realize

information sharing capabilities to improve situational awareness,

enhance decision making, and facilitate collaboration.

• Net-Centric Operations Division (NCOD) promotes policies and strategies for information sharing and coordinate investment and development of network-enhancing capabilities – Work to make the information understandable by:

• Defining an ontology (or shared vocabulary)

• Documenting required information exchanges

• Provisioning services to improve discoverability, re-use, understandability

– Work to make the information discoverable and accessible through • Service registry, Semantic Metadata Catalog and Portal

– Help to identify accurate and timely data • Identifying Authoritative Data Sources, which provide accurate and timely

data

• Incorporating metadata about the accuracy and timeliness of data

Semantic Metadata Catalog and Portal Extended Capabilities

•Utilizes existing SOA Registry capabilities

•Addresses cross-agency information exchanges

•Facilitates collaboration

•Focuses on discoverability of defined information exchanges

•Takes full advantage of Semantic Relationships defined in ontologies

SOA Registry Scope

•Governed within an Agency

•Focused on discoverability of published services

•Supports only flat, non-semantic data

•Focused on governance

Bottom Line:

• Utilizes semantic discovery

capabilities

• Yields a more targeted result set

• Provides an intelligent search

beyond simple keywords

Net-Enabled Test Environment (NETE) • Concept

– Virtual test environment – no new facility

– Government and industry participation

– Experimental approach – test, measure, evaluate, adjust

– Adopting existing projects; leveraging progress

• Benefits

– Data sets made available will bring interested developers

– Allows demonstration of concepts to flesh out requirements

– Allows trade-off studies for architectural decisions – standards, processes, TTPs, tools, infrastructure design

– Tests Governance model for efficiency

– Accessible to all NextGen participants; can link to outside data sources/consumers

– Leverages work already done by NextGen stakeholders

Semantic Web Technologies

• Semantic Web (aka Linked Data or Web 3.0) is a set of W3C standards and technologies designed to allow machines to understand the meaning of the information on the WWW

• Standards-based

• Open-source tools

• Agent-based distributed computing paradigm

• Web Oriented Architecture

• Agile Development, improved interoperability

• Semantic Web in the Enterprise: A tool for knowledge discovery and management

• Common Vocabulary

• Open Linked Data

• Intelligent Searches

• Semantic Web in the Industry

• US government and leading social network companies have been implementing semantic-driven solutions

Semantic Mediation Bus™ (SMB)

• An ontology-based web services mediation component that enables services

with different message formats to interoperate

• Embedding in an Enterprise Service Bus (e.g. SWIM Enterprise Messaging

Service) enables runtime semantic mediation within traditional SOA

infrastructure, creating a Semantic Mediation BusTM
